自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(1)
  • 收藏
  • 关注

原创 Java源码中查找方法汇总(待完善)

Java的API中提供了很多Util,这篇文章将对我看的源码里面的排序方法进行总结:1. 二分查找法a) Arrays.binarySearch(Object[] a, Object key)前提:a要先做好排序,并且是正向排序返回值:如果key在a中,则返回key在a的位置,否则返回key应在a的插入点+1的和的负值。  PS:我会在探索中不断补充本文。...

2018-12-26 00:57:25 276

转载 The class name of an array object

Quote from Java API documentation https://docs.oracle.com/javase/8/docs/api/java/lang/Class.html#getName--If this class object represents a class of arrays, then the internal form of the name consi...

2018-12-25 21:51:20 104

转载 Precedence of Spring boot customize configuration

A note from book Spring boot in Action, 1st edition by Craig Walls , chapter 3:There are, in fact, several ways to set properties for a Spring Boot application. Spring Boot will draw properties fro...

2018-12-15 22:03:16 217

原创 Samsung S8+ 欧版 Google Play服务耗电快解决方案尝试

之前入手了S8+ 64GB的欧版,原版系统无刷机修改,因此自带Google全家桶。前段时间发现手机耗电很快(一个下午就能吃掉30%多的电量),看到系统的耗电排行榜,Google Play服务稳居前三。然而这时候如果给他连上十几分钟的VPN,接下来耗电量就会减少很多。个人猜测是由于国内的网络环境导致Google频繁的去请求服务。上网搜了一下,也发现有种说法是Google会去频繁测试当前的wifi...

2018-12-04 22:06:04 6555

原创 What if there is a return statement in finally block?

In normal situation this is how we use the try-catch-finally statement:try { //Code}catch (Exception e) { //Handle the exceptional case}finally { //Clean up code to be executed no mat...

2018-09-24 14:13:51 288

原创 使用Builder来解决多成员Bean的初始化问题

自己在做开发的时候,遇到过自己抽象的一个Bean类,拥有很多的成员变量。我们对这些个成员变量设置了private权限,然后用getter和setter来获取和设置变量值。在创建这些Bean类的实例的时候,有时候是因为懒(不想一个个的调用setter去设值),又或者是怕自己忘记给某个成员赋值(为此我可能还会在时候这些成员变量的时候再判断了一次是不是未赋值,又多写了一些代码),我又会给Bean类写一个...

2018-09-24 00:57:41 245

转载 使用java的java.security.MessageDigest类进行不可逆加密

/** * MD5加码。32位 * @param inStr * @return */ public static String MD5(String inStr) { MessageDigest md5 = null; try { md5 = MessageDigest.getInstance("MD5"); } catch (Exception e) {

2013-06-24 12:07:28 715

转载 数据库利用出生日期查询(年龄)的sql语句

oracle: select  出生日期,   to_char(sysdate,'YYYY') - to_char(出生日期,'YYYY')   as 年龄  from  dbo.A001 ms sql: select datediff(year,出生日期,getdate())   as '年龄'    from  dbo.A001 mysql: select (Y

2013-06-01 16:00:56 33450

广东工业大学计算机图形学试卷

截止至2011年图形学考试试卷和模拟试卷,部分有答案参考

2012-12-29

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除